A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CAPE
CANAVERAL, BREVARD COUNTY, FLORIDA, AMENDING SECTION 2-
56 OF THE CITY CODE TO MODIFY THE STARTING TIME OF
REGULAR CITY COUNCIL MEETINGS FROM 7:00 PM TO 6:00 PM;
PROVIDING FOR THE REPEAL OF PRIOR INCONSISTENT
ORDINANCES AND RESOLUTIONS; INCORPORATION INTO THE
CODE; SEVERABILITY; AND AN EFFECTIVE DATE.
WHEREAS, the City is granted the authority, under Section 2(b), Article VIII, of the
State Constitution, to exercise any power for municipal purposes, except when expressly
prohibited by law; and
WHEREAS, the Section 2.01 of the Cape Canaveral City Charter provides that City
Council shall meet regularly at least once in every month at such times and places as the City
Council may prescribe by rule; and
WHEREAS, the City Council desires to modify the starting time for regular City
Council meetings from 7:00 PM to 6:00 PM; and
WHEREAS, the City Council of the City of Cape Canaveral, Florida, hereby finds this
Ordinance to be in the best interests of the public health, safety, and welfare of the citizens of
Cape Canaveral.
BE IT ORDAINED by the City Council of the City of Cape Canaveral, Brevard
County,Florida, as follows:
Section 1. Recitals. The foregoing recitals are hereby fully incorporated herein by this
reference as legislative findings and the intent and purpose of the City Council of the City of
Cape Canaveral.
Section 2. Code Amendment. Section 2-56 of the Code of Ordinances, City of Cape
Canaveral, Florida, is hereby amended as follows (underlined type indicates additions and
strikeout type indicates deletions):
Sec. 2-56. - Regular meetings.
The city council shall hold regular meetings on the third Tuesday of each month
at 7:00 6:00 p.m. The city council may, on an as-needed basis, begin its regular meetings
prior to 700 6:00 p.m. When the day fixed for any regular meeting falls upon a day
designated by law as a legal national holiday, such meeting will not be held. Regular
meetings may be otherwise postponed, canceled or rescheduled by consensus of the city
council. All regular meetings shall be held in the place as designated by a majority of the
council in open session.

Section 3. Repeal of Prior Inconsistent Ordinances and Resolutions. All prior inconsistent
ordinances and resolutions adopted by the City Council, or parts of prior ordinances and
resolutions in conflict herewith, are hereby repealed to the extent of the conflict.
Section 4. Incorporation Into Code. This Ordinance shall be incorporated into the Cape
Canaveral City Code and any section or paragraph, number or letter, and any heading may be
changed or modified as necessary to effectuate the foregoing. Grammatical, typographical, and
like errors may be corrected and additions, alterations, and omissions, not affecting the
construction or meaning of this Ordinance and the City Code may be freely made.
Section 5. Severability. If any section, subsection, sentence, clause, phrase, word or provision
of this Ordinance is for any reason held invalid or unconstitutional by any court of competent
jurisdiction, whether for substantive, procedural, or any other reason, such portion shall be
deemed a separate, distinct and independent provision, and such holding shall not affect the
validity of the remaining portions of this Ordinance.
Section 6. Effective Date. This Ordinance shall become effective immediately upon adoption
by the City Council of the City of Cape Canaveral, Florida.
ADOPTED by the City Council of the City of Cape Canaveral, Florida, this 17th day of
July, 2012
